Católica-Lisbon SBE has once again been shortlisted for the 2026 Human Resources Awards, in the Higher Education Institutions category, reinforcing its outstanding contribution to the development of future leaders.
Part of the 15th edition of the initiative “As Empresas Mais,” promoted by Human Resources Portugal, these awards recognize organizations and leaders who stand out for best practices in people management, organizational culture and talent development.
A total of 34 awards will be presented, 30 of which are subject to public voting, open until May 3. The category in which Católica-Lisbon SBE is nominated is available for voting here.
With more than 50 years of history, Católica-Lisbon SBE has established itself as a pioneering school in management education in Portugal, bringing together a global community of over 16,000 alumni, now holding leadership positions in leading national and international organizations. The winners will be announced at the Awards Ceremony, which will take place on May 14 at Quinta da Pimenteira, in Lisbon.
